2009 Teens' Top Ten Book List
Teens' Top Ten is a "teen choice" list, where teens nominate and choose
their favorite books of the previous year! Nominators are members of
teen book groups in fifteen school and public libraries around the
country.
Nominations are posted on Support Teen Literature Day during National
Library Week, and teens across the country vote on their favorite titles
each year. Readers ages 12-18 voted online between August 24 and
September 18; the winners will be announced in a webcast featuring WWE
Superstars and Divas during Teen Read Week.
